Understanding Concrete Cutting

Concrete cutting involves slicing through concrete surfaces to modify the structure or design of a building. Unlike demolition, concrete cutting is precise and controlled, allowing workers to make exact adjustments without causing unnecessary damage.

Importance of Proper Techniques

Utilising proper concrete cutting techniques is crucial for ensuring the safety of workers and the integrity of the remaining structure. Poor cutting practices can result in cracking, structural damage, and increased project costs.

Key Techniques in Concrete Cutting

Some of the essential techniques in concrete cutting include the use of wall sawing, wire sawing, and core drilling. Each method serves specific purposes and requires specialised tools and expertise.

Wall Sawing

Wall sawing is typically used for creating door or window openings. It involves a circular blade that is mounted on a track, allowing for precise and efficient cuts through vertical and horizontal surfaces.

Wire Sawing

Wire sawing is ideal for large concrete structures, such as bridges and reinforced concrete slabs. This technique employs a cable with diamond segments, capable of slicing through steel-reinforced concrete without generating excessive dust and noise.

Core Drilling

Core drilling enables the creation of precise holes in concrete slabs, walls, and ceilings. It is often used for utility installations, such as plumbing or electrical systems. This technique minimises disturbance to the surrounding structure.

Choosing the Right Equipment

The selection of appropriate equipment is vital for successful concrete cutting. Factors such as the thickness and location of the concrete, as well as project-specific requirements, should be considered when choosing equipment.

Safety Considerations

Concrete cutting involves several safety risks, including exposure to dust and noise, potential injury from equipment, and structural instability. Adherence to safety protocols and the use of protective gear are essential to protect workers.

Project Planning and Execution

Effective planning is key to executing a successful concrete cutting project. This includes assessing the site, determining the most appropriate cutting techniques, and scheduling the work to minimise disruptions to surrounding areas.

Environmental Impact

The environmental impact of concrete cutting can be significant, particularly concerning dust generation and waste disposal. Implementing dust control measures and recycling concrete waste can mitigate these effects.

Innovations in Concrete Cutting

Recent innovations have led to more efficient and environmentally friendly concrete cutting methods. Developments such as advanced diamond cutting tools and automated machinery enhance precision and reduce the impact on the environment.
